Description

Benzoic Acid, m-Nitro-, Salicylidenehydrazide is a specialized organic compound belonging to the class of hydrazone derivatives. This high-purity chemical is valued for its role as a versatile intermediate and analytical reagent in advanced chemical synthesis and research. It is primarily sought by professionals in the pharmaceutical, agrochemical, and fine chemical industries for developing active ingredients and complex molecules.

Application

  • Pharmaceutical Intermediate: Used in the synthesis of novel drug candidates and active pharmaceutical ingredients (APIs), particularly those requiring a hydrazone functional group.
  • Agrochemical Synthesis: Serves as a key building block in the development of advanced pesticides, herbicides, and plant growth regulators.
  • Chelating Agent & Metal Ion Sensor: Functions as a ligand for metal ions in analytical chemistry and material science, useful in sensor development and catalysis.
  • Organic Synthesis Reagent: Employed in research laboratories for constructing complex heterocyclic compounds and conducting condensation reactions.
  • Polymer Additive Precursor: Can be utilized in the development of specialty polymers and stabilizers with enhanced properties.

Basic Information

Product Name Benzoic Acid, m-Nitro-, Salicylidenehydrazide
CAS No. 82859-78-7
Molecular Formula C₁₄H₁₁N₃O₄
Molecular Weight 285.26 g/mol
Synonyms m-Nitrobenzoic acid salicylidenehydrazide; 2-Hydroxybenzaldehyde (3-nitrobenzoyl)hydrazone; Salicylaldehyde m-nitrobenzoylhydrazone; N'-(2-Hydroxybenzylidene)-3-nitrobenzohydrazide; (E)-N'-(2-Hydroxybenzylidene)-3-nitrobenzohydrazide; 3-Nitro-N'-(2-oxidobenzylidene)benzohydrazide; Benzhydrazide, N-(2-hydroxybenzylidene)-3-nitro-
